The genus Pourthiaea Decne., a deciduous woody group with high ornamental value, belongs to the family Rosaceae. Here, we reported newly sequenced plastid genome sequences of Pourthiaea beauverdiana (C. K. Schneid.) Hatus., Pourthiaea parvifolia E. Pritz., Pourthiaea villosa (Thunb.) Decne., and Photinia glomerata Rehder & E. H. Wilson. The plastomes of these three Pourthiaea species shared the typical quadripartite structures, ranging in size from 159,903 bp (P. parvifolia) to 160,090 bp (P. beauverdiana). The three Pourthiaea plastomes contained a pair of inverted repeat regions (26,394-26,399 bp), separated by a small single-copy region (19,304-19,322 bp) and a large single-copy region (87,811-87,973 bp). A total of 113 unique genes were predicted for the three Pourthiaea plastomes, including four ribosomal RNA genes, 30 transfer RNA genes, and 79 protein-coding genes. Analyses of inverted repeat/single-copy boundary, mVISTA, nucleotide diversity, and genetic distance showed that the plastomes of 13 Pourthiaea species (including 10 published plastomes) are highly conserved. The number of simple sequence repeats and long repeat sequences is similar among 13 Pourthiaea species. The three non-coding regions (trnT-GGU-psbD, trnR-UCU-atpA, and trnH-GUG-psbA) were the most divergent. Only one plastid protein-coding gene, rbcL, was under positive selection. Phylogenetic analyses based on 78 shared plastid protein-coding sequences and 29 nrDNA sequences strongly supported the monophyly of Pourthiaea. As for the relationship with other genera in our phylogenies, Pourthiaea was sister to Malus in plastome phylogenies, while it was sister to the remaining genera in nrDNA phylogenies. Furthermore, significant cytonuclear discordance likely stems from hybridization events within Pourthiaea, reflecting complex evolutionary dynamics within the genus. Our study provides valuable genetic insights for further phylogenetic, taxonomic, and species delimitation studies in Pourthiaea, as well as essential support for horticultural improvement and conservation of the germplasm resources.
